Transaction 398944784bc17fdaadd10a64650a74bfaecf94b4ec0b56c6a6f66e371ec720a2
1 Input
1 Output
-
398944784bc17fdaadd10a64650a74bfaecf94b4ec0b56c6a6f66e371ec720a2:0
- value
- 83044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f912e93ac56ce6ff6dbdcc9d3b982b3baf6d0d7c OP_EQUAL
- address
- 3QPzqGm38YjiMqChGWnQ2poEHJvQpfJr3h